Taliban (IEA) Minister Signs Extraction Contract of Amu Oil Field With Chinese Company

5th January, 2023 · admin

Khaama: The area of this contract is estimated 4500 square kilometers, scattered in the country’s three northern provinces including Saripul, Jawzjan and Faryab. In the contract, it is stated that Afghanistan’s share is 20 percent at present, and it will reach up to 75 percent in the future. Click here to read more (external link).
